Woman Faces Charges After Barricading Herself In Northern Westchester Home, Police Say A Northern Westchester woman is facing charges after allegedly threatening a worker at her home. Police were called to the house on Gerard Court in Yorktown Tuesday, April 19, for a reported dispute between a resident and workers at the home, Yorktown Police said. Officers determined that the 44-year-old woman, whose name was not released, had pointed what appeared to be a gun at one of the workers and threatened to shoot him, police said. Man Threatens Postal Worker With Knife In Mohegan Lake A postal worker in the area was threatened by a man with a knife, state police said. At approximately 1:30 p.m. on Friday, July 26, state police troopers were dispatched to the Mohegan Lake Post Office on East Main Street in the town of Cortlandt for a report of a man with a knife.  An investigation found Charles Coles, 54, of Cortlandt, used a pocket knife to threaten a postal worker in the parking lot, police said.
